Hi!

Next week finally my first release for Vampire will be coming. Sadly no Heretic 2 yet.

It will be a new Quake 2 port, but with some things AmiQuake2 does not offer:

- Background Music (at least if you have a V4 Vampire, sadly no Background Music for V2 systems - I am using a V4 specific chipset feature here)
- Optional support for the USB Gamepad of the Vampire V4 (for A1200 + V2 Vampire and similar configurations lowlevel.library and PSX Port Adapters are supported)
- You can set 3 sources for an action like in the AmigaOS4 version (mouse, keyboard, gamepad)
- Network Gaming
- Full Support for MissionCDs and Multiplayer Mods
- 68080 specific compiled version included
- New Installer installing Q2 from either PC CD, Mac CD, Gog Data or Steam Data (Gog or Steam Data needed for the Background music, or you can rip the CD Audio from the CD into AIFF format yourselves - Vampire version of my port uses AIFF for background music, if you have Gog/Steam version the installer will do the needed file conversion already)

Note this port will need Picasso96 and AHI installed. Future updates (with potentially more optimization for 68080) might happen.

There is also already a MiniGL renderer, additionally to the Software renderer, so if the Vampire in future gets a working MiniGL Implementation for Maggie this port is already prepared (It is a general 68k port, with special versions for Vampire, PiStorm and 100 MHz 060 systems, you can choose at installation time which of them to install).

Maggie lacks features required for Q2. Basically it requires 3 different Blending Modes (but actually if one of them is supported the others could be approximated by it) and it requires glTexEnv both GL_REPLACE and GL_MODULATE (Maggie only supports on of them).
 
  Of course once more features are added to Maggie, this could be supported. A MiniGL Renderer is included additionally to the Software renderer.
